How should i begin?
Assuming schools in your country adequately prepare you for university then there is no point in learning school and university curriculum ahead of time just for learning it ahead of time. It'll merely increase the amount of boredom in maths and physics classes that anyone with a bit of talent for the subjects experiences, anyways (except if you're at a really good and/or elitist school that can afford to offer demanding math and science classes). I believe you're better off by playing around with a few projects you find interesting, instead.
If you want a random proposal for such a project: write a program that simulates the motion of a number of hard metal spheres in a two-dimensional box with a gravitational attraction pointing downwards for different temperatures or different total energies and play around with it, perhaps see if there is some kind of phase transition to be seen. In a second step, you can add some attraction or repulsion between the spheres. Of course I cannot guarantee that you find that interesting, but such a project is feasible for a 14 year-old with adequate programming skills (you can always learn the skills you may be missing) and will probably keep you occupied for a few weeks, at least if you write the thing from scratch. |
